Apply now Job no: 500045 Work type: Permanent Location: Townsville Categories: Registered Nurse/Midwife About the role Mater Private Hospital Townsville has an exciting opportunity for a Floor Coordinator in our Perioperative Services unit.
Within this full-time permanent role, the successful candidate will work as part of the senior staff team to meet the departmental objectives and develop the work of the theatre service.
Salary range: $54.21 - $58.08 per hour (Registered Nurse Level 2) plus superannuation and salary packaging $107,501 - $115,161 per annum plus superannuation and salary packaging What you'll be doing As the Floor Coordinator you will be responsible for ensuring a safe, efficient, and effective service is provided to patients and Visiting Medical Officers within Perioperative Services on a day-to-day basis.
You will provide clinical expertise, direct support and coaching to staff within the department, with a clear focus on the patient experience and quality of services.
Ensuring appropriate staff allocations and skill mix to reflect the changing workload and to meet patient needs.
Coordinate all clinical activity to maximize efficiency and ensure staff meal breaks and reliefs are arranged in a timely manner.
To act as a clinical expert within the area of work demonstrating specialist knowledge, skills, and expertise.
To liaise and co-operate with the wards, other departments, and personnel in the hospital.
Work collaboratively with other team leaders in the theatre department in the daily running and organisation of theatre activity and provide support in all clinical areas as necessary.
To maintain and raise the clinical standard of care through the process of audit, and as a result implement changes in best practice.
Identify and communicate quality improvement ideas to senior staff to enhance patient care.
About you To be successful in this role you will meet the following: Registration with Australian Health Practitioner's Regulation Agency with a current licence to practice as a Registered Nurse.
Advanced clinical knowledge and experience in a clinical area or specialty applicable to the unit.
Minimum of 5 years' experience in Perioperative Nursing.
Demonstrated advanced ability to communicate complex and challenging information constructively.
